On January 29, Chapman Men’s Crew competed in the Long Beach Sprints: a 2000 meter race on an indoor rowing machine (ergometer). Unlike previous years in which our presence was limited, this year our team was able to compete in force, making this a true representation of the progress we made over interterm practice. Out of 6 rowers who competed, 5 received medals in their respective divisions.

Varsity:

Heavyweight Varsity: Philip Englert 1st Place

Lightweight Varsity: Jake Weinberg 2nd Place

Novice:

Heavyweight Novice:

Michael Lee 1st Place

Mark Nolasco 3rd Place

Lightweight Novice:

Chandler Thorn 3rd Place
